搭建smaba實現(xiàn)windows與linux匿名共享

前言:

成都創(chuàng)新互聯(lián)公司是一家專注于成都網(wǎng)站制作、成都網(wǎng)站建設(shè)與策劃設(shè)計,西青網(wǎng)站建設(shè)哪家好?成都創(chuàng)新互聯(lián)公司做網(wǎng)站,專注于網(wǎng)站建設(shè)十余年,網(wǎng)設(shè)計領(lǐng)域的專業(yè)建站公司;建站業(yè)務涵蓋:西青等地區(qū)。西青做網(wǎng)站價格咨詢:18980820575

    講道理來smaba作為一個簡單的服務,而且不經(jīng)常用到,是沒必要寫成一片博客的。不過在此過程中還是遇到不少坑,全部踩過之后,記錄下來反而感覺還有有那么一絲絲必要的,

正文:

    說道文件共享,nfs也基本滿足需求了,不過如果想實現(xiàn)linux與windows之間的文件共享,nfs就滿足不了了?;谟脩粽J證的samba服務暫且不提,主要講講如何實現(xiàn)匿名共享,也就是無論windows訪問共享還是其他linux訪問共享都不用密碼,話不多說開整!

    第一步肯定是先安裝必要的服了咯~

yum install samba samba-client samba-comm

    smaba就是我們要用到的服務端程序,samba-client字面意思很明顯就是客戶端程序,samba-comm主要用到的是testparm語法檢查指令。

    接著啟動服務

service smb start                 #很明顯centos6系統(tǒng)哈

    然后就是寫配置文件了,我們配置文件分為兩大部分[global]標識下的是全局配置,對samba本身的配置,[共享資源名] 特定的共享資源名下的就是專有的共享配置。我們先來修改全局配置。

        [global]
        workgroup=xiaofengfeng            #工作組名
        security = share                  #以匿名的方式共享
        map to quest = Bad User           #這很重要?。。。∠旅嬖敿氄f明

    map to quest = Bad User這條配置非常重要,有了這條配置,windows才能匿名訪問samba共享,且不會提示你輸入密碼?。。。》浅V匾?。不過如果你用testparm會提示Unknown parameter encountered: "map to quest",不用管它!接下來就是共享配置了!

[project]
        comment = smbuser's project          
        path    = /home/project                   #要共享的目錄路徑
        browseable = yes              #是否能查看到此共享,如果設(shè)置為no就不能在客戶端顯示
        read only = yes    #設(shè)置為只讀,與writable不要同時存在,如果同時存在以最后的最主         
        writable = yes                #是否可以在共享目錄寫入文件
        guest ok = yes

我們可以用testparm命令來確保配置沒問題。博主共享配置測試配置文件測試輸出如下:

[project]
	comment = smbuser's project
	path = /home/project
	read only = No
	guest ok = Yes

接下來接是重啟服務,并且確保/home/project的權(quán)限能讓nobody讀或?qū)?,確保iptables放行samba的端口,確保已經(jīng)關(guān)閉了selinux。這些都是坑?。。。。。。?!為了確保能訪問就做如下配置:

service restart smb
iptables -F
setenforce 0
chomd 777 /home/project

根據(jù)自己的能力可對上面的權(quán)限進行限制。到此就實現(xiàn)了windows與linux之間的共享啦~~~

我們可以用smbclient -L \\127.0.0.1來測試samba服務是否可訪問。提示輸入密碼直接按回車鍵就好~輸出信息如下:

Domain=[XIAOFENGFENG] OS=[Unix] Server=[Samba 3.6.23-33.el6]

	Sharename       Type      Comment
	---------       ----      -------
	IPC$            IPC       IPC Service (Samba Server Version 3.6.23-33.el6)
	project         Disk      smbuser's project
Domain=[XIAOFENGFENG] OS=[Unix] Server=[Samba 3.6.23-33.el6]

	Server               Comment
	---------            -------

	Workgroup            Master
	---------            -------

在linux端可以把共享文件掛載到某個目錄下,比如

mount -t cifs //172.16.254.182/project /mnt    #172.16.254.182為samba

win鍵就是那個開始鍵~~

搭建smaba實現(xiàn)windows與linux匿名共享

搭建smaba實現(xiàn)windows與linux匿名共享

新聞標題:搭建smaba實現(xiàn)windows與linux匿名共享
URL標題:http://muchs.cn/article4/iiooie.html

成都網(wǎng)站建設(shè)公司_創(chuàng)新互聯(lián),為您提供ChatGPT微信小程序、服務器托管、響應式網(wǎng)站、外貿(mào)網(wǎng)站建設(shè)、網(wǎng)站排名

廣告

聲明:本網(wǎng)站發(fā)布的內(nèi)容(圖片、視頻和文字)以用戶投稿、用戶轉(zhuǎn)載內(nèi)容為主,如果涉及侵權(quán)請盡快告知,我們將會在第一時間刪除。文章觀點不代表本網(wǎng)站立場,如需處理請聯(lián)系客服。電話:028-86922220;郵箱:631063699@qq.com。內(nèi)容未經(jīng)允許不得轉(zhuǎn)載,或轉(zhuǎn)載時需注明來源: 創(chuàng)新互聯(lián)

搜索引擎優(yōu)化